The vectors like velocity, displacement, and acceleration act along different directions in the two-dimensional motion. Resolving the vectors into the vertical and horizontal components allows the application of one-dimensional kinematic equations in each direction separately. It helps solve the problems more accurately and also simplifies the analysis.

Recently, NIELIT Patna cutoff 2025 for the Round 1 seat allotment has been released by the institute for the admission to BTech and BTech Integrated courses. As per the JEE Main 2025 cut off data, the B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ering rank stood at 50162 for the General AI category candidates. Similarly, for the OBC AI quota, the rank stood at 18790.
